What happens to the Church bells on the Thursday before Easter?
a. They stop ringing
b. They ring all day
c. They ring every hour
![Page 13: Easter In France](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022081505/5559859ad8b42a14638b46bb/html5/thumbnails/13.jpg)
a. They stop ringing. Supposedly gone to see
the Pope.

Who delivers presents to children on Easter Sunday?
a. The Easter bunny
b. The Church bells
c. The Easter chick
![Page 19: Easter In France](https://reader035.vdocument.in/reader035/viewer/2022081505/5559859ad8b42a14638b46bb/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
b. The Church bells. On their way back from
Rome
